Top High Paying Jobs in India

Software Engineer and IT Professionals

The technology sector continues to dominate the list of high-paying jobs. Software engineers, developers, and IT professionals are in high demand due to the growth of digital transformation.

Professionals working in areas like web development, app development, artificial intelligence, and cybersecurity earn some of the highest salaries in India.

Entry-level salaries start from ₹4–8 lakh per year and can go up to ₹20 lakh or more with experience. Skilled professionals in top companies or with international clients can earn even higher.


Data Scientist and Data Analyst

Data science has become one of the most lucrative career options in India. Companies rely on data to make business decisions, which increases the demand for data professionals.

A data scientist analyzes complex data, identifies trends, and helps companies improve performance. Data analysts also play an important role in handling and interpreting data.

Entry-level salaries range from ₹6–10 lakh per year and can reach ₹25 lakh or more with experience and expertise.


Doctor and Medical Professionals

Healthcare is one of the most respected and high-paying fields in India. Doctors, surgeons, and specialists earn high salaries along with social respect.

The income depends on specialization, experience, and type of hospital or clinic. Specialists such as cardiologists, neurologists, and surgeons earn significantly higher than general practitioners.

Although this field requires long years of study and dedication, it offers excellent long-term rewards.


Chartered Accountant (CA)

Chartered Accountancy is one of the top career choices in commerce. Chartered Accountants handle financial management, taxation, auditing, and business advisory.

A qualified CA can earn between ₹7–15 lakh per year initially, and experienced professionals can earn ₹20 lakh or more. Those who start their own practice have the potential to earn even higher income.


Management Professionals (MBA Graduates)

MBA graduates from reputed institutions often secure high-paying roles in management, marketing, finance, and operations.

Positions such as business manager, marketing manager, HR manager, and financial analyst offer strong salary packages.

Fresh MBA graduates can earn ₹5–10 lakh per year, while experienced professionals can earn ₹15–30 lakh or more depending on the role and company.


Investment Banker

Investment banking is one of the highest-paying careers in India, especially for finance professionals.

Investment bankers help companies raise capital, manage investments, and handle mergers and acquisitions.

The starting salary is usually around ₹10–15 lakh per year and can go much higher with experience and performance.


Commercial Pilot

A career as a commercial pilot is both exciting and highly rewarding. Pilots are responsible for flying aircraft and ensuring passenger safety.

The salary of a pilot in India starts from ₹10 lakh per year and can go up to ₹50 lakh or more with experience and international flights.

However, the training cost is high, and proper certification is required.


Digital Marketing Specialist

With the growth of online businesses, digital marketing has become one of the fastest-growing and high-paying career options.

Professionals in this field handle SEO, social media marketing, content marketing, and online advertising.

Freshers can earn ₹3–6 lakh per year, while experienced professionals and experts can earn ₹10–20 lakh or more. Freelancers and agency owners can earn even higher income.


Lawyer and Legal Advisor

Law is another prestigious and high-paying profession in India. Experienced lawyers, especially those working in corporate law, earn significant income.

Starting salaries may be moderate, but with experience, lawyers can earn ₹10–25 lakh per year or more. Top legal advisors and senior advocates earn even higher.
